​Hutton: Arsenal would get 'fantastic player' in Marseille left-back Amavi

Marseille defender Jordan Amavi would be an excellent signing for Arsenal.

That is according to former defender Alan Hutton.

Le10Sport have recently claimed Amavi may sign with Arsenal as their new backup left back for next season.

Hutton played alongside Amavi at Aston Villa and believes the 27-year-old would benefit Mikel Arteta's side.

"I actually read that story earlier this morning," Hutton told Football Insider.

"He is a great guy. Everybody really liked him in the squad [at Aston Villa]. For me personally, I thought he was a fantastic player. He's really gone away and shown that at Marseille, which is a massive club on its own.

"He was always a talented player. Again, very attack-minded, he could get caught out once or twice but I think he's improved that. He's a little bit older now, he's experienced the Premier League so he knows what he's stepping into.

"If he goes to Arsenal, they're a massive club trying to get back to those top European places. He will have great competition with Tierney there.

"For a young French boy to come in, he just got on with everybody. He was funny and everybody really liked him. It's nice to see him getting his rewards."
